The Certification Process: A Deep Dive
So, what exactly do these certification bodies *do*? Their primary function is to independently assess and verify the fairness and integrity of online casino games. This process is rigorous and multifaceted, covering everything from the game’s random number generator (RNG) to its payout percentages and overall gameplay. Let’s break down the key aspects:
Random Number Generators (RNGs): The Heart of the Game
The RNG is the engine that drives virtually every online casino game. It’s a complex algorithm that generates a sequence of numbers, determining the outcome of each spin, deal, or roll. Certification bodies meticulously test these RNGs to ensure they are truly random and unbiased. This involves statistical analysis, simulating millions of game rounds, and verifying that the results fall within acceptable parameters. They look for patterns, biases, and any potential vulnerabilities that could be exploited.
Payout Percentage Verification: Know Your Return
Every casino game has a theoretical payout percentage, also known as Return to Player (RTP). This figure represents the percentage of all wagered money that the game is expected to pay back to players over the long term. Certification bodies verify that the game’s RTP matches the advertised figure. This is crucial for players, as it gives them a realistic expectation of their potential returns. The auditors run simulations, often involving billions of game rounds, to confirm that the actual payout aligns with the stated RTP. If a game’s RTP is found to be significantly lower than advertised, it will fail the certification process.
Game Integrity and Security: Protecting Your Data
Beyond fairness, certification bodies also assess the security of the game and the platform it runs on. They check for vulnerabilities that could be exploited by hackers or malicious actors. This includes testing the encryption of data, ensuring the integrity of the game files, and verifying that the platform adheres to industry best practices for security. They are also looking at how the game handles user data, and whether it complies with data protection regulations, such as GDPR. This is particularly important for Irish players, as it ensures that their personal and financial information is protected.

Key Certification Bodies to Watch For
Several reputable certification bodies operate in the online gambling industry. These organisations are recognised for their expertise and independence. Here are some of the most prominent ones:
- eCOGRA (eCommerce Online Gaming Regulation and Assurance): Based in the UK, eCOGRA is one of the most respected certification bodies in the industry. They offer a wide range of services, including game testing, RTP audits, and dispute resolution. Their seal of approval is a strong indicator of a casino’s trustworthiness.
- GLI (Gaming Laboratories International): GLI is a global leader in testing and certification services for the gaming industry. They have a long history and a strong reputation for their rigorous testing procedures. They provide services to both land-based and online casinos.
- BMM Testlabs: Another well-established testing lab, BMM Testlabs, offers comprehensive testing and certification services. They are known for their expertise in a variety of gaming platforms and technologies.
- iTech Labs: iTech Labs is an Australian-based testing laboratory that provides certification services to online casinos and game developers. They are known for their fast turnaround times and their commitment to fairness.
When choosing an online casino, always look for the seals of approval from these or other reputable certification bodies. These seals are usually displayed prominently on the casino’s website, often in the footer. If you don’t see any, it’s a red flag.
